Manal:
Hi Harminder
Resveratrol is mainly in the skin and seeds of red grapes which i don't think they are included in these juices. Also the concentration of the juice in these packs are 15% to 20% of the whole pack and the rest is sugar, water and flavors, so i guess that fresh juice or the grapes themselves will be much better than preserved juices
